Castigate

Castigate verb - To criticize (someone) severely or angrily especially for personal failings.
Usage example: castigated him for his constant tardiness

Flay

Flay verb - To criticize (someone) severely or angrily especially for personal failings.
Usage example: her husband flayed her constantly for her incessant shopping
